To submit a nomination, email the requested information as one PDF attachment to oed@cies.us.
All nominations must include:
- Name, affiliation, and contact information for the person nominated.
- Summary statement indicating that appropriate guidelines have been met.
- Brief paragraph stating the rationale for nomination (100-150 words).
- Contact information of the person making the nomination.
Should a nominee be included on the election ballot, the nominator will then be asked to help secure the following information from the nominee at a later date:
- Biography (250-500 words)
- CV
- Photo
- Short candidate statement (250–500 words) outlining their vision for CIES

Terms in Office
The Vice President shall be elected for a 1-year term and automatically and successively shall become the President Elect for a 1-year term, the President for a 1-year term, and the immediate Past President for a 1-year term.
The Treasurer, Secretary, Student Representative, and two Board Members each serve a 3-year term.
Start of Service
Newly elected officials will begin their terms during the State of the Society business meeting at CIES 2026 in San Francisco, scheduled for March 28-April 1, 2026.
